Задвоение кнопки «Купить в один клик» от плагина «Art WooCommerce Order One Click»

1 Звезда2 Звезды3 Звезды4 Звезды5 Звезд (1 оценок, среднее: 5,00 из 5)
Загрузка...

Описание проблемы.

После установки плагина «Art WooCommerce Order One Click», на сайте в карточке товара происходит задвоение кнопки «Купить в один клик».

Используется:

WopdPress версии 5.2.2

WooCommerce версия 3.4.5

Art WooCommerce Order One Click  версия 2.2.7

Убираем задвоение кнопки «Купить в один клик»

После анализа кода плагина, выяснилось что вывод кнопки цепляется на метку WooCommerce


<?php do_action( 'woocommerce_after_add_to_cart_button' ); ?>

а такая метка используется в двух местах в шаблонах WooCommerce, это в следующих:

woocommerce\templates\single-product\add-to-cart\variable.php

woocommerce\templates\single-product\add-to-cart\simple.php

точнее в четырех, но они взаимоисключаются, так что по сути в двух в которых одновременно используются.

Переопределяю шаблон variable.php в теме, и там уже убираю метку woocommerce_after_add_to_cart_button

Как переопределить шаблон WooCommerce

Для этого в своей теме создаю такую структуру папок и файлов

woocommerce/single-product/add-to-cart/variable.php

в самом плагине woocommerce заложено это переопределение темой.

1 комментарий

  • oprol evorter

    Very interesting info !Perfect just what I was looking for! «If you want to test your memory, try to recall what you were worrying about one year ago today.» by Rotarian.

Добавить комментарий для oprol evorter Отменить ответ

Ваш e-mail не будет опубликован. Обязательные поля помечены *